About The Position

Crown Equipment Corporation is a leading innovator in world-class forklift and material handling equipment and technology. As one of the world’s largest lift truck manufacturers, we are committed to providing the customer with the safest, most efficient and ergonomic lift truck possible to lower their total cost of ownership.

Responsibilities

  • Provide basic hardware/software technical support and assistance to clients via email, phone, and/or other remote methods.
  • Address and respond to customer inquiries on current and future company technology, such as InfoLink, Auto Positioning System (APS) and Automated Guided Vehicle (AGV) products and services, including installation, operational functions, troubleshooting, and maintenance.
  • Provide customers with preventive maintenance and configuration recommendations to improve product usability, performance, and customer satisfaction.
  • Document client interactions, including details of inquiries, complaints, comments, and actions taken.
  • Possess a basic understanding of the organization's products and services but escalates more complex inquiries to a Tier 3 support group.
  • Assist the delivery of on-going training for end users and the Company's Dealer/Branch support network.
  • Provide afterhours support for national accounts as required, as well as on-call weekend support when assigned.
